摘要
Increasing energy demands has led to expansion of power infrastructure which also means that there is an increase in the number of lines subjected to faults due to short circuits or unintentional causes such as birds, falling of branches, etc,. Sometimes this causes an outage of power. Identification of the right fault type is necessary for quick power restoration. Hence accurate fault classification in power distribution substation is essential. The work presented in the paper aims to automate the fault type identification process using a fuzzy based algorithm thereby reducing the time required for power restoration. The experimental results indicate that the algorithm accurately detects the type of fault in single and multiple fault scenarios.
